<description>&lt;p&gt;A blogger named Stephen Plaut created the &quot;All the Other Rachels&quot; meme back in May or June of 2004, in response to my work about Rachel Corrie, &quot;The Skies are Weeping.&quot;  Performances of that work were cancelled in Anchorage and NYC because of serious threats to artists and producers, before we were finally able to produce it in London, on November 1, 2005.

To me, the most ludicrous aspect of the &quot;all the other Rachels&quot; idea is this:  From the start, I&apos;ve been asked again and again, either rhetorically or actually &quot;Why didn&apos;t YOU write about these other Rachels?&quot;  This is silly.  I wanted to write about Rachel Corrie.  Nothing I&apos;ve done, and other composers and poets and playwrights have said about Rachel Corrie has been an attempt to diminish the memory of these other innocent women.  And nothing we&apos;ve done has prevented anybody else from creating art about &quot;the other Rachels.&quot;  The fact that this meme keeps appearing - going on three yerars now - without any of the idea&apos;s adherents coming forward with such art, speaks for itself.
